Job description

We are seeking a talented and creative Web Designer to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for designing visually appealing, user-friendly websites that align with our brand identity and meet client specifications. This role offers an exciting opportunity to utilise a broad range of digital design skills, including UX, UI, and front-end development, ensuring engaging online experiences across multiple platforms. The successful applicant will work closely with developers, content creators, and marketing teams to deliver innovative web solutions that optimise user engagement and functionality., * Develop innovative website layouts and visual concepts using tools such as Adobe Photoshop, Adobe XD, Figma, and Adobe Illustrator.

  • Create wireframes, prototypes, and interactive mockups employing Axure, Balsamiq, InVision, and Visio to facilitate user research and usability testing.
  • Implement responsive web design principles using HTML, CSS, Bootstrap, SCSS, Less (style sheet language), and JavaScript frameworks like React, Angular, Redux, AJAX, and Node.js.
  • Conduct user research to understand target audiences' needs and preferences to inform design decisions.
  • Optimise websites for search engines (SEO) using best practices in content management systems such as WordPress and Drupal.
  • Maintain existing websites through regular updates, troubleshooting issues related to website maintenance or content management systems.
  • Collaborate with developers on front-end development tasks ensuring seamless integration of design elements with back-end technologies like PHP and MySQL.
  • Analyse website data using Google Analytics and data analysis skills to improve usability and overall performance.
  • Ensure all designs adhere to accessibility standards and information architecture best practices for enhanced usability.
  • Participate in usability testing sessions to refine user interfaces based on feedback.
